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Supply Chain Management, Business, or a related field.
- 5+ years experience supporting SAP, particularly in logistics and supply chain modules.
- Strong experience with Transportation Management platforms and transportation business processes.
- Knowledge of transportation execution, freight rating, carrier management, and logistics compliance.
- Experience with system integrations (SAP IDocs, EDI transactions, XML/API-based interfaces).
- Experience in project management.
